Why Watch? Because there’s nothing like taking The Wizard of Oz, combining it with Apocalypse Now, and telling it all exploitation style.

In this short flick, Dorothy lives a shitty life, but she’s asked to follow the yellow road to Kurtz (The Wizard) and to kill him. The Wizard’s gone crazy, and he’s not fit for command anymore.

Recasting the Scarecrow as a hitchhiking stoner, and the Wicked Witch as a local policeman that loves the smell of napalm in the morning, the short also plays some clever referencing gags (like Dorothy’s big pink bubble gum bubble in place of Glinda The Good Witch’s pink orb). Plus, you can’t go wrong with M.C. Gainey as a mad Kurtz.

The horror, the horror. There’s no horror like home.

APOCALYPSE OZ (2006)

Written and Directed By: Ewan Telford

Starring: Alexandra Gizela, M.C. Gainey, Billy Briggs, and Kevin Glikmann
